Introduction
Northeast Alabama Community College offers an HVAC Technician program at its campus in Rainsville, Alabama. This comprehensive program is designed to train students to become certified HVAC technicians in the state of Alabama. The program is accredited by the HVAC Excellence and the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ools Commission on Colleges.

Program Accreditation
The HVAC Technician program at Northeast Alabama Community College is accredited by HVAC Excellence, an independent organization that recognizes HVAC programs that meet the highest standards and have a proven track record of producing skilled and knowledgeable HVAC technicians. The program is also accredited by the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ools Commission on Colleges (SACSCOC), which is the primary accrediting agency for colleges and universities in the southern United States.

Is it on Campus or Online?
The HVAC Technician program at Northeast Alabama Community College is offered entirely on-campus. Students will attend classes and labs on the Rainsville campus and will receive hands-on training in the latest HVAC technologies.

Program Courses
The HVAC Technician program at Northeast Alabama Community College consists of the following courses:

  • Introduction to HVAC Systems
  • HVAC Electrical Systems
  • HVAC Refrigeration Systems
  • HVAC Troubleshooting and Repair
  • HVAC Systems Design and Installation

Prerequisites
In order to be eligible for the HVAC Technician program at Northeast Alabama Community College, applicants must have a high school diploma or equivalent. Applicants must also pass an entrance exam and have a valid Alabama driver’s license.

How to Apply
To apply for the HVAC Technician program at Northeast Alabama Community College, applicants must submit an online application, which can be found on the school’s website. Applicants must also submit transcripts from their high school or GED program, as well as a copy of their valid Alabama driver’s license.

How Long Does the Program Take?
The HVAC Technician program at Northeast Alabama Community College takes approximately one year to complete. Upon successful completion of the program, students will receive a Certificate of Completion from the school.

HVAC Technician Associate Degree Programs

Associate degree programs are designed for students who want a comprehensive education in HVAC. These programs typically take two years to complete and provide a mix of theoretical and hands-on training. Upon completion, you will receive an associate degree in HVAC, which can be used to qualify for entry-level positions in the industry.

HVAC Technician Bachelor’s Degree Programs

Baccalaureate degree programs are designed for students wanting a more advanced HVAC education. These programs typically take four years to complete and cover more topics than associate degree programs. Upon completion, you will receive a baccalaureate degree in HVAC, which can be used to qualify for higher-level positions in the industry, such as management or design roles.
